6628932
0x0bbc41f36e771c01331a9d6d9c3a071ce72ead97d8a75ef4060a782966466a9b
Transactions0
Height6628932
Confirmations9520857
Timestamp804 days 7 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xb28ef09b140f3d96
Bits
Difficulty0xf48e2e2